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 28 is 28
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 28 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 2 = 28,
30/14 = 30 × 2/14 × 2 = 60/28 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 28 × 1 = 28,
56/28 = 56 × 1/28 × 1 = 56/28 - Add the two like fractions:
60/28 + 56/28 = 60 + 56/28 = 116/28 - 116/28 simplified gives 29/7
- So, 30/14 + 56/28 = 29/7
